FENIX Resources Ltd
Fenix Resources Limited provides mining, logistics, and port services in Western Australia. The company's flagship property is the 100% owned Iron Ridge Iron Ore project located in Western Australia. It operates three iron ore mines in the Mid-West region of Western Australia. Annual Total Assets for FENIX Resources Ltd (2008–2025)
The table below shows the annual total assets of FENIX Resources Ltd from 2008 to 2025.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-06-30 | AU$364.47 Million | +36.62% |
| 2024-06-30 | AU$266.78 Million | +41.50% |
| 2023-06-30 | AU$188.54 Million | +23.72% |
| 2022-06-30 | AU$152.39 Million | +30.70% |
| 2021-06-30 | AU$116.59 Million | +1434.77% |
| 2020-06-30 | AU$7.60 Million | -13.77% |
| 2019-06-30 | AU$8.81 Million | +1809.12% |
| 2018-06-30 | AU$461.48K | -64.92% |
| 2017-06-30 | AU$1.32 Million | -30.22% |
| 2016-06-30 | AU$1.89 Million | -49.36% |
| 2015-06-30 | AU$3.72 Million | -47.43% |
| 2014-06-30 | AU$7.08 Million | -1.84% |
| 2013-06-30 | AU$7.21 Million | -16.81% |
| 2012-06-30 | AU$8.67 Million | -23.70% |
| 2011-06-30 | AU$11.37 Million | +30.74% |
| 2010-06-30 | AU$8.69 Million | +91.72% |
| 2009-06-30 | AU$4.53 Million | -11.52% |
| 2008-06-30 | AU$5.13 Million | -- |
